Bioinformatics and Applied Genomics Programme Grant to develop research and training centres/networks in Africa, Asia and Latin America
Universities, research institutions and research organizations in Africa, Asia and Latin America are invited to apply for TDR programme grants to develop training centres/networks for research and training in bioinformatics and applied genomics. The centres will focus on infectious and parasitic diseases, and be developed to support and train scientists from the three regions. The ultimate goal is to establish sustainable research and training facilities by promoting utilization of genomics in developing disease endemic countries.
Grant details
The sum of US$ 45,000 will be awarded as initial support
for improvements in computer, internet, and LAN infrastructure
in the centres. The grant will also be used to cover
the costs of travel and accommodation for students,
staff, and at least three facilitators from outside
the region to training workshops and courses. Support
may be renewed annually subject to satisfactory evaluation.
